INSURANCE RISKS.

AGAINST STRIKES AND RIOTS,

By Cable—Press Association— Copyright. London, February 11.

The Corn Trade Association has given notice that insurance policies, tenderable under contracts from March 1 most cover risks of strikes, riots and civil commotions, which Lloyd's standard policy excludes. It is understood the underwriters will accept these risks at a minimum premium of a shilling per cent.
